Transaction 64b1039be51a26000a4c1954d739e885477e958fcfff27057a53dcffe0d74161

1 Input
2 Outputs
  • 64b1039be51a26000a4c1954d739e885477e958fcfff27057a53dcffe0d74161:0
  • value  10440720
    address  37wQrRMRSsHWURc2L2PdK6mGc3V8VBULhA
  • 64b1039be51a26000a4c1954d739e885477e958fcfff27057a53dcffe0d74161:1
  • value  176854
    address  1BeLjbhYB9wmhyGAV3qPMA8r9Tp8VHyxnT